为什么要学习Rust?
-
IT工程师修炼之道中有个建议,如果想要抵抗技术过时带来的风险,就得每年学一门语言。语言学得多并不会混淆,而且还会有一种一通百通的感觉。
Rust连续第五年成为Stack Overflow年度调查中,工程师最喜欢的编程语言是有它的道理的。
Rust的本质是在改善C++,它和Java通过GC,VM字节码等来改善C++的方向不一样,它一来就是加强编译器,通过编译器来虐工程师。所以刚开始学习Rust的曲线是有些陡峭的,首先你得和Rust编译器达成共识,让它变成你的朋友。
对于Rust后面的发展,很多人比较看好。已经有人在用Rust开发一些落地应用了,比如:huggingface的tokenizer。
除此之外,还有很多科技公司和开发者也参与了进来。非凸科技就是Rust量化先驱者,目前正基于Rust生态打造高效率、低延迟、高可靠全内存高频交易平台,持续为券商、量化私募等众多大型金融机构提供优质的算法服务。
对于Rust在高频量化交易领域的应用,在未来既是机遇也是挑战,期待Rust重构整个世界。
要想成为高手,终身学习是必备条件。如果你想学习Rust,又对量化感兴趣,那么欢迎加入非凸!
【应聘岗位】Rust开发工程师
【投递邮箱】recruit@ft.tech
【微信沟通】354334592
【工作地点】北京/上海/成都/新加坡
【公司官网】https://ft.tech